About Design Jobs in Toronto roles
Toronto's booming tech sector, fueled by a robust talent pipeline from institutions like OCAD University and Canada's progressive tech visa policies, has established the city as a premier hub for product designers and UX researchers. The local ecosystem features a vibrant mix of homegrown unicorns like Shopify, Wealthsimple, and 1Password alongside global enterprise outposts, creating a dynamic landscape where creatives can tackle complex, large-scale problems. While absolute compensation for designers in Toronto may be slightly lower than in San Francisco or New York, the strong purchasing power, universal healthcare, and an increasing volume of remote-friendly US roles make it an exceptionally attractive market for top-tier design talent.
Hiring demand for design professionals in Toronto remains robust, with a noticeable shift toward hybrid roles at mid-stage startups and enterprise SaaS companies. While overall open headcount has stabilized compared to the previous year's peak, there is a growing premium for senior product designers who possess strong UX research capabilities and experience in AI-driven interfaces.
